Since yesterday it´s absolutly impossible to use the Explorer. I had the problem a few days before too, but it went away after a simple restart. So i tried this today but it´s no use. After startup the explorer is fast (normal speed I am used to) for about 10 seconds, and then it begins to lag. I deinstalled the newest Update (KB3197954) from a few days ago but there is no difference. So i tried the 2nd (KB3199986) one , but it´s impossible because selecting it takes about 1 min. and after a right click on it the "deinstall" button doesn´t show up, even after 10 min. Windows like Task Manager or the unpack window from Winrar are empty for about 1-2 min., only the frame shows up and when I move the windows I have the typical Windows XP window glitch/drag we all know. Windows Defender has problems too. It´s slow AF and selecting a thing takes 2-3 min also. (I made a quick scan with it, no problem found)

Other programms run as smooth as before, Firefox etc.

 

Please help.

Ok, seams to be a temporary problem. The PC ran now for about half an hour and the problems disappeared. So I thought "why not restart and try if its there again". Done, and they are there again, in a lighter manner. So I would say there is something in the backround that draws power. But the taskmanager doesn´t show anything out of the ordernary. CPU at 2-5%, storage at around the same, RAM at normal 2.5Gb from 16. Strange.

try verifying your windows files, maybe something got corruptedresource 1. also check the system error logresource 2 if everything verify's. if you don't want to check the logs than you can try resetting the settings or maybe even resetting windows entirely while keeping your files.
